Tennessee Statutes
§ 56-5-205 — Filing of credit scoring models
Tennessee·Title 56
Insurers that use insurance scores to underwrite or rate risks must file their scoring models or other scoring processes with the department of commerce and insurance. A filing that includes insurance scoring shall include loss experience justifying the use of credit information. The filings shall be kept confidential by the commissioner of commerce and insurance and shall not be construed to be a public record pursuant to title 10, chapter 7.

Legislative History
Acts 2004, ch. 527, § 6.
